Marketing Coordinator

 

Job Responsibilities and Requirements: The Marketing Coordinator assists the Chief Marketing Officer and Director of Marketing with the planning, implementation and administration of marketing and business development programs. This position works closely with other members of the Marketing Department and the Managing Directors/Sales Teams. Responsibilities: Review requests for proposals (RFPs) and assist in qualifying the opportunity, identifying sales team, drafting contents, attending sales team meetings, and establishing deadlines Write, edit and design/format proposals and new business presentations that lead to increased sales; Develop high-impact business development documents reflecting the firm s brand identity, messaging and positioning within tight deadlines; Create and distribute monthly pipeline report of prospect opportunities and status Coordinate final proposal/presentation production, including printing and binding hard copies, emailing electronic copies, and confirming delivery Assist with coordinating event logistics, including database development, invitations, RSVPs, etc. for client, prospect, and networking events; Coordinate the distribution of internal and external marketing literature; Maintain the contact management database system and coordinate the development of mailing lists; Research and prepare target prospect lists; Research prospects and industries; Assist in writing and creating presentations; Other responsibilities as necessary. Skills/Experience/Education: BA or BS in Marketing, Communications, or English strongly preferred. Advanced degree a plus; 0-3 years of experience working in a marketing department of a professional services firm, strongly preferred; Strong Word, PowerPoint, Excel skills required; Adobe Illustrator and/or Photoshop, or other design software experience preferred; Experience assisting with the creation and administration of a professional services marketing program and have an understanding of what good, quality creative design looks like preferred; Experience working with creative vendors; Excellent written and oral communications skills required; Excellent analytical and research skills necessary; The ability to self-direct, organize, prioritize and manage multiple projects a must.
